The wheels started turning for Katy Moms Network in the early Spring of 2018, after recognizing a true need in the community. We wanted to create a community where local moms could go for resources and information, while also being a source for inspiration, community and togetherness, and support. We thought, if we can give moms the gift of time and community, we’ve done our job!
We launched Katy Moms Network in June of 2018 and it’s been a beautiful whirlwind journey ever since! In short, Katy Moms Network is a resource-rich website with local events and information that all moms need, as well as blog features and a space to support local businesses. We also do monthly Mom Meet Ups in the community to bring moms together and have an awesome following on social media where we can connect with mamas of all walks of life in the Houston area!
